AMES, Iowa (KCRG) – The Iowa State men’s basketball team interrupted all activities indefinitely due to the program’s COVID-19 protocols, according to a statement released on Friday.

Due to the break, Saturday’s game in Kansas was postponed.

“The priority for us is the safety and well-being of everyone in our program,” said coach Steve Prohm in the statement. “While it is disappointing that we cannot play this weekend, we are looking forward to returning to the competition when it is safe to do so.”

No determination has been made for any future ISU games at this time.
